SB is 18/4.

I put SB on AK, TT+, so was worried he had a higher set or A of diamonds. At least on the turn. I checked behind on river without thinking too much. Comments welcomed.

PokerRoom No-Limit Hold'em, $0.50 BB (10 handed) Hand History Converter Tool from FlopTurnRiver.com (Format: FlopTurnRiver)

MP1 ($13.95)
Hero ($28.20)
MP3 ($26.40)
CO ($26.95)
Button ($15.50)
SB ($27.50)
BB ($26.40)
UTG ($14.60)
UTG+1 ($14.25)
UTG+2 ($57.35)

Preflop: Hero is MP2 with 6, 6.
UTG calls $0.25, 2 folds, MP1 raises to $1, Hero calls $1, 3 folds, SB raises to $1.75, 1 fold, UTG folds, MP1 calls $0.75, Hero calls $0.75.

Flop: ($5.75) Q, J, 6 (3 players)
SB bets $2, MP1 folds, Hero raises to $7, SB calls $5.

Turn: ($19.75) K (2 players)
SB checks, Hero bets $5, SB calls $5.

River: ($29.75) 4 (2 players)
SB checks, Hero checks.
